Local Auto Parts Stores

A Mr. Windshield

Dallas, TX


CONTACT INFO

Phone:

(972) 263-8497

ADDRESS

A Mr. Windshield
13455 Noel Rd
Dallas, TX 75240

More Auto Parts Stores in Dallas

13455 Noel Rd Dallas, TX, 75240 Map

AUTO PARTS STORE PROFILE


A Mr. Windshield



Auto Part Selection:
  • Auto Glass / Windshield
  • Auto Parts